Default Need Info

Can I buy a WW book and calculator without being a member? There's a book with all the points in it, so I don't have to join, right?

And what book do I buy? I might be able to get it off Amazon...one with the point system. Some books don't, according to what I researched so far.

I want to lose 30 pounds and I'm trying to educate myself on different diets.

Go to the WW website and check out the shop. If you look at the WW at home kit that will show you what books you need. Which site you go to depends on where you live.

I know you can buy stuff on ebay. But it's kind of expensive. You may be better off joining WW for a month, getting the info and material you need and then go at it alone. The meetings really are great and so worth it, but I know in today's economy it's hard to work it in the budget. Just my opinion.
